Z-Man's Short Ribs
You'll want to fire up the smoker for this one! This delicious recipe was sent in by one of our top customers. It is the perfect meal for a Sunday afternoon dinner with friends and family. We recommend serving it with Purple Potatoes to really wow your guests!
  • Prep Time:
  • Cook Time:
  • Servings: 4

Ingredients

  • (4 lbs) Beef Short Rib
  • (2 Tablespoons) Olive Oil
  • (To taste) Rib/Beef Rub

Directions

Prep - 

  1. Remove the thin membrane on the inside of the ribs.
  2. If desired, cut ribs into smaller pieces by cutting between the bones. (This will cut down on cooking time + enhance flavor)
  3. Rub olive oil onto ribs as a binder for your spices to adhere better/
  4. Rub your favorite rib or beef rub onto all sides. This may be done up to 24 hrs. beforehand to allow spices to marinate in the meat. (I like to use Twist'D Q Sweet Heat Rib Rub, something with brown sugar and other spices for a little extra kick!)

Smoking -

  1. Set your smoker to 225 degrees Fahrenheit. I like to use hickory chips or pellets for beef, but most woods would work well. 
  2. This will always be a long smoke, so use a water pan in the smoke chamber.
  3. Place the ribs on the racks and insert a meat thermometer into one of the largest pieces. Smoke until they reach an internal temperature of 200 degrees Fahrenheit. With a thick rib, this may take up to 5 hours.
  4. Let rest for 5-10 minutes and enjoy!
